When you pickpocket an NPC, the NPC gets a spell cast on them that expires in 40 hours Skyrim time or 7200 seconds real world time. When this spell expires, their inventory is reset.Do items in NPC houses Respawn Skyrim?
Will they ever respawn or I'll run out soon of gold to steal? They respawn. You have to stay out of the cell for the entire time or else it resets the respawn timer, though. So don't check the shop every 2 days hoping for a respawn, you're just resetting the timer every time you do that.How long does it take for items to Respawn Skyrim?
Most areas are set to respawn after ten days of not being loaded, others are thirty days.How long does it take for NPC to Respawn in Skyrim?

Ore veins typically replenish their ores every 30 in-game days, allowing players to revisit mining locations periodically to collect more resources. However, the length of time it takes for ore to respawn can vary depending on certain factors.Does loot Respawn in Skyrim?
Most locations in the game are respawning. This happens, depending on the location, at scheduled times. When a game location respawns, its enemies and loot are usually reset. This allows revisiting previously visited locations, which will have their contents reset.Do Draugr respawn?
Draugr or Skeletons are seen in groups of 1 to 3 in the vicinity and will respawn after normal Draugr spawn time. Rarely there are Body piles or Evil Bone Piles in or near the forts. These forts have a chance of containing a chest and Moder Vegvisir.Do the mines in Skyrim replenish?
Mining is done at ore veins scattered throughout the Skyrim overworld. Each ore vein will yield 1-3 samples of the ore it supplies, and will sometimes also drop gems. Ore veins will resupply after you deplete them, after a month has elasped in the game.What happens to dead NPCs in Skyrim?

Try opening the console (` key by default), clicking on the NPC in question, and typing "resetAI". That should reset the NPC's AI and hopefully unstick her. If that doesn't work, you can try "recycleactor", but that may have side effects. The character will show up at their default position.Do chests in your house reset Skyrim?
The following containers will never reset, thus they are permanently safe to store items.
- All chests and containers inside purchasable houses.
- All containers in the Abandoned House in Markarth.
- The chest in Delphine's secret room inside the Sleeping Giant Inn.
- The end table and wardrobe inside the ruined Helgen Inn.

Ore veins typically respawn every thirty in-game days. A method that can be used to replenish ore veins faster is to enter and exit a nearby location of the source (a nearby cave/house/mine etc.) one week after depleting the ore.Do iron veins replenish Skyrim?
The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im Special EditionYes, they do. How long does it take for ore to Respawn in Skyrim? Ore veins generally replenish their ores after about a month (in-game) if the area is marked as "cleared". Otherwise, it replenishes in 10 days.

There is a flawless sapphire and a flawless amethyst in the Temple of Dibella in Markarth, inside the inner sanctum on a shelf. These gems will respawn after a week in-game.How often do giants Respawn Skyrim?
Do mammoths and giants respawn in Skyrim? - Quora. They do. Most of the game spaces in Skyrim reset after 10 in-game days, replenishing their supply of items and inhabitants at that time. Dungeons and camps which are marked “cleared” (meaning you defeated a boss there at some point) will instead take 30 days to reset.Do flowers regrow in Skyrim?
Once you have harvested a plant's ingredient, some or all of its flowers and stems disappear, allowing already-harvested plants to be easily identified. Harvested plants will later respawn, at which point you can again harvest their ingredients.
